Board summary. Stellix hardware line retires end of fiscal year. Rationale: margin erosion, component scarcity, overlap with Orventa platform. Support commitments honoured for 24 months. Remaining stock routed through the Dellmarsh outlet channel. Staff at the Carnhaven facility to be redeployed; no redundancies planned. Customer comms embargoed until board ratification. Pricing on Orventa upgrades held flat through transition. Questions via line managers only. The confidential statement of onward business plans follows below.

board note of yadup-fajef: Druiusox Holdings is in early talks to buy Norwynek Systems for about $186.0 million. The Kaseth launch date is June 24, and nothing goes to the press before then. Legal wants the Quenethek Group term sheet withdrawn before November 27.

Minutes — Lunesdale Software Management Meeting
Attendees: Heads of Department.

Churn in the Bracken pilot programme reached 18% this quarter, concentrated among smaller accounts onboarded in the first wave. Exit interviews cite setup complexity and unclear pricing tiers. R. Tamsin will simplify onboarding; pricing review assigned to M. Odel. A retention dashboard goes live next month. Remedial commitments and forward plans are recorded in the confidential note below.

management briefing: The renewal with Quenathox Group closes at $10 million a year, 20 percent below the last contract. Project Ulawyn slips by two quarters because of the supplier delay.

TURN-208: Gatevale turnstile counters at the Merrow Field pilot double-count when a rotation reverses mid-cycle. Attendance totals drift roughly 2% high per event. The debounce window fix is implemented, reviewed by Ilsa, and soak-tested across two simulated match days without drift. Ready for your cut; the candidate build is identified below.

trace token, tagag-tafog: htk6_5ed18c

## Onboarding: HarrowLink Telemetry Gateway

The HarrowLink gateway ingests CAN-bus telemetry from Fieldmarch tractors and forwards normalized readings to the Silostream analytics service. It runs as a systemd unit on the edge boxes; config lives in `/etc/harrowlink/gateway.toml`. Maintainers should know the gateway authenticates to Silostream with a service-level API key rotated twice a year. For your first deployment, configure the gateway with the current key shown below.

gateway credential: qvz15-KH6w5OvQFD1Z8FT